    Beacons is a lovely small town with potential to grow as a thriving micro downtown. There's a…read morebrewery (my favorite of all breweries) and plenty of vintage shopping. What it does lack, however, is a standalone boba shop. While Asahi is, first and foremost, a poke restaurant, it does offer a selection of boba teas and slushies. The weather had just turned from dreary cold to summery hot, so I was craving my favorite Asian drink. After some hand-wringing (I couldn't decide which one to get), I finally settled on an iced strawberry tea with milk foam. I wasn't confident in my order, but all my anxieties allayed at first sip. It was delicious! The boba was soft, the strawberry flavors came through strongly without tasting artificial, and the milk foam added a complex layer of creaminess and saltiness that elevated the drink altogether. Even my husband, who's not much of a boba drinker, thought it was great (and kept stealing sips). If you're in Beacon and you're suddenly hit with a hankering for boba, try Asahi.

    Poke bowls are a staple in my "healthy fast food" rotation. If you've never had it before, it's…read morebasically like a Hawaiian version of Chipotle with raw fish. This location is consistent with the quality and service at its other location in Englewood. Interior is clean and bright with a large group table and bar seating. You can build your own bowl or choose from a signature menu with pre-selected ingredients. I built my own (~$17) and filled out a sheet with a list of ingredients. You can choose 2 bases, 2 proteins, 6 toppings, 2 sauces, and 4 garnishes. Just a side note for those who don't like raw fish: they have options with cooked meat like shrimp tempura and fried chicken. I chose brown rice, spicy tuna, smoked salmon, mango, pineapple, tamago, seaweed salad, pickled ginger, red onion, nori, candied walnuts, and cashews. I topped everything off with spicy mayo and ponzu soy sauce. Service was super quick as I was the only one there. Everything was fresh! My bowl was sweet, savory, and spicy. It was just the right portion size to satisfy my hunger, but not enough to put me in a food coma.

    I was so excited to have my poke bowl with a side of a yummy bubble tea…read more The poke still bomb, fresh and a great portion. They have pre made bowls or you can build your own which is my fav! The place clean and cute and of course, packed and full of life. The staff upbeat and friendly which is what we love! Unfortunately I had to give them one less star for this rating (compared to my previous 5 star) because their bubble tea changed, not only their packaging but their quality. The cup felt flimsy, like if you squeeze too hard might pop the cover off, no big deal if the actual drink is great, then you bypass this BUT unfortunately this has to be one of the saddest bubble tea drinks I've had in a while. The drink was warm!!! Ugh, the ice was added last so therefore it melted immediately and so by the time it got to me, warm... I'm like ok I can add ice at home lol .. I had the mango and my boyfriend the peach. Both flavors were good, but both warm with ice is just not the same. We had it with tapioca bubbles and mango/peach popping boba. The popping boba was good but the tapioca pearls were SOOO HARD and a weird orange see through color so either they weren't ready or they were old! They were so hard they kept clogging our straw and couldn't sip our drink... everything about it was just a disappointment, I was so sad because I've been going there for years and I've loved their bubble tea and never had that problem! Anyway, go for food, skip their bubble tea.
